Role description:
Arcadis is seeking a Mechanical Engineer to join our Design & Engineering teamwithin the North America Places group. We are looking to grow our team of skilled multi-discipline engineers and engineering consultants throughout North America. The role sits within our Places Global Business Area (GBA). We work with our clients around the world to create, support, and enhance smart, safe, and sustainable places where people live, work, learn and thrive. Places impact on the quality of peoples lives through new or redeveloped Data Center, Transit Facility, Commercial and Retail, Mixed-Use Residential, Institutional/Educational, and Social Infrastructure developments.
Arcadis is the second largest architectural firm in the world. Join us in our journey to become the largest engineering firm in the world by expanding our reach in the Northern Texas region.
In this role, you will be accountable for providing first-in-class solutions to internal and external clients through your technical expertise in mechanical engineering and associated building systems. You will use your knowledge of HVAC, plumbing, piping, and similar building systems in combination with an affinity for client interaction to provide sustainable, high-quality deliverables ranging from front end planning reports to issue for Construction document packages.
This position has flexible working hours, and you will join a collaborative team that truly values its people. This is a key location based position. While work scopes may be located throughout the United States, we are searching for individuals in the Dallas area to support our existing world-class Retail architectural practice.
